The ASTM D5673 platinum-cobalt color scale test is a widely recognized method for assessing the aesthetic quality of water by measuring its color. This color measurement can help identify potential contamination sources, ensuring compliance with regulatory standards and maintaining the integrity of potable water supplies.

This testing procedure provides a standard reference that allows stakeholders to compare water samples consistently across different regions or laboratories. By employing this method, organizations can ensure they meet rigorous international standards for water quality. The test is particularly useful in sectors like municipal water supply, industrial processes requiring high purity water, and environmental monitoring.

The ASTM D5673 procedure involves several key steps: sample preparation, color measurement using a platinum-cobalt solution, and interpretation of results against the standard scale. Proper sample preparation ensures accurate and reliable test outcomes. It is crucial to follow specific procedures outlined in the standard, including ensuring proper storage and handling of samples.

Once the water sample has been prepared, it undergoes color measurement using a platinum-cobalt solution. This method compares the color intensity of the water sample against a series of standardized platinum-cobalt solutions with known color intensities. The resulting value indicates how much platinum would be required to produce an equivalent color in a platinum-cobalt solution.
